I use 7.1:1 for spinner baits all the time. Also, a more accurate indicator of the reel speed is how much like is recovered with 1 full revolution.

Give the spinner baits a shot on the 7:1. There are definitely times of the year where burning a spinnerbait on a 7:1 works, and fall is one of them. Just my 2 cents.
